Natalia Ramas

Born in Gudalajara in 1993, Natalia Ramas studied Audiovisual Communication at Tec de Monterrey and did a postgraduate course in Art Direction at Elisava in Barcelona. She is mainly interested in abstraction and decontextualisation of objects and different materials. Natalia Ramas proposes different atypical compositions and expresses her ideas through "still lifes" of objects and sculptures.

The artist has designed three editions for Château La Coste, real collage games in which Ramas' ceramic sculptures are presented in a dreamlike landscape alongside totally decontextualised objects.
